Community Budget Issue Requests - Tracking Id #2869
Salvation Army Children's Village
 
Requester: Major Gary Elliot Organization: The Salvation Army
 
Project Title: Salvation Army Children's Village Date Submitted 1/14/2005 3:19:00 PM
 
Sponsors: Sebesta
 
Statewide Interest:
This continuing project addresses a gap in Florida's foster care system. The Childrens' Village provides stability by providing a nurturing environment for sibling children by keeping them together in groups. The Village provides homes with professional foster parenting and coordination of social services for the children.

Project Description:
The Salvation Army Children's Village is a neighborhood of typical family homes with professional foster parenting and coordination of all services to meet the children's needs. These homes provide stable, family-style foster care for sibling groups
 
Is this a project related to 2004 hurricane damage? No
 
Measurable Outcome Anticipated:
Stable family-style foster care for sibling groups, resulting in improved academic performace and behavior of the children in the program.
